The correct answer is - C. Polar easterlies, prevailing westerlies, and trade winds.

These are the three dominant types of winds on our planet. They are influenced by multiple factors, such as the movement of the Earth and the ocean currents. In general they have a constant direction of movement and are occupying certain places of the planet by which they have also gotten their names.

The polar easterlies are winds that are dominant around the poles and their closer surrounding area.

The prevailing westerlies are dominant in the mid-latitude places on our planet (between the polar easterlies and the trade winds).

The trade winds are dominant winds at the Equator and its closer surrounding areas.
